Job Summary
The Intern, Solution Integration is responsible forcollaboration in the life cycle of Software Engineering, setting up, anddelivering solutions created by the Solution Architects, System Designers, andSoftware Developers. The incumbent acts as an intermediary between thedifferent stakeholders in a project by ensuring that the project teamunderstands the solutions at all times and that the applications across complexsystems work together flawlessly. The role specializes in delivering solutionsto all stakeholders and contributes to design decisions that drive theintegration of application and solutions. The team delivers monitoringsolutions to all applications and devices across the CN network. In addition,the team provides automation services, ranging from automating standardInformation and Technology (I&T) requests to automated remote devicesinstallations and deployments, such as Locomotives, Wayside Messaging Servers,Key Exchange Service, and Crossing.

About CN
CN is a premium railroad that sustainably generates value for our customers, shareholders, employees, and stakeholders with an unwavering commitment to safety and service. Essential to the economy, to the customers, and to the communities it serves, CN safely transports more than 300 million tons of natural resources, manufactured products, and finished goods throughout North America every year. CN's network connects Canada's Eastern and Western coasts with the U.S. South through a 20,000-mile rail network. CN and its affiliates have been contributing to community prosperity and sustainable trade since 1919. CN powers the North American economy and is committed to programs supporting social responsibility and environmental stewardship.
